    First try AirPort Utility 5.6 for Mac OS X Lion. If that version does not install, go on to the next series of steps.
    Here are the basic steps to install version 5.6 under OS X Lion (versions 10.7.3 +) or OS X Mountain Lion using CharlesSoft's Pacifist:
    If you haven't already download the AirPort Utility disk image file directly from Apple Support Download
    Place the resultant AirPortUtility56.dmg file onto your Mac's Desktop.
    Run Pacifist.
    Click on the Open Package option. Find the disk image file that you just placed on your desktop, and then, click on Open.
    The utility is located as follows: Contents of AirPortUtility56.dmg > Contents of AirPortUtility56.pkg > Contents of AirPortUtility56Lion.pkg > Applications > Utilities > AirPort Utility 5.6.app
    Drag AirPort Utility 5.6.app to your Mac's /Applications/Utilities folder.
    You can now run the AirPort Utility from the Utilities folder.

    The info notes on AirPort Utility 5.6.1 indicate that it will not run on Lion 10.7.x.  It will run on Snow Leopard 10.6.x or Leopard Macs 10.5.x.
    AirPort Utility 5.6 for Mac OS X Lion is what you need, as it can be used on your Mac running Lion to configure both the original and previous generation AirPort Express models.

    AirPort Base Station: How to set up and configure an 802.11g AirPort Extreme Base Station or AirPort Express in OS X Lion
    AirPort Utility 6.2 in Lion or Mountain Lion does not support an older 802.11g device, so advising the user to download and install AirPort Utility 6.2....when it is very likely already installed on a Lion or Mountain Lion machine .....does not solve the issue here.
    AirPort Utility 5.6....which the user needs to configure the 802.11g AirPort Extreme.....cannot be installed on 10.7.5 or any 10.8.x Macs without using some workarounds.....not supported by Apple as far as I can tell.
